Short Interest in V2X, Inc. (NYSE:VVX) Declines By 21.9%

V2X, Inc. (NYSE:VVXGet Free Report) was the target of a significant drop in short interest in the month of August. As of August 31st, there was short interest totalling 164,600 shares, a drop of 21.9% from the August 15th total of 210,800 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 64,900 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 2.5 days. Currently, 1.5% of the company’s stock are sold short.

V2X Stock Performance

Shares of NYSE:VVX traded up $0.39 during mid-day trading on Friday, reaching $48.36. 137,674 shares of the company traded hands, compared to its average volume of 44,856. The company’s 50 day moving average price is $50.33 and its 200-day moving average price is $45.70. The firm has a market cap of $1.51 billion, a PE ratio of -34.06 and a beta of 1.01.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.20, a current ratio of 1.10 and a quick ratio of 1.10. V2X has a 52 week low of $34.55 and a 52 week high of $56.75.

V2X (NYSE:VVXG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, August 8th. The company reported $1.01 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.66 by $0.35. V2X had a positive return on equity of 12.75% and a negative net margin of 1.12%. The company had revenue of $977.85 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$898.53 million.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$1.41 EPS. The firm’s revenue was up 96.3% on a year-over-year basis. On average, equities analysts expect that V2X will post 4.12 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About V2X

(Get Free Report)

V2X, Inc provides critical mission solutions and support services to defense clients in the United States and internationally. It offers a suite of integrated solutions across the operations and logistics, aerospace, training, and technology markets to national security, defense, and civilian clients.
